BRUCE SMITH’S, FINE WINE SELECTED TO SCREEN AT THE CASTRO THEATRE OCT 11 AND 12


FINE WINE, Written and Directed by SFSDF student, Bruce E. Smith was selected to screen at the Good Vibrations Erotic Film Festival at the Castro Theatre. Fine Wine will be playing at the Castro Theater on October 11th and 12th to the thrill of audiences. It is a rare opportunity to get screened on one of the largest remaining single screen theaters in the Country (it seats 1400).

San Francisco School of Digital Filmmaking (SFSDF) is one of the most innovative film schools in the country. Offering programs in both Digital Filmmaking and Film Acting, SFSDF bridges the gap between traditional education and professional moviemaking. Our intensive and hands-on programs are designed to prepare students for a successful career in the motion picture industry. The innovative curriculum is taught by award-winning filmmakers and is project-based, with students creating their own movies and working on professional feature-length motion pictures. SFSDF students learn the art and craft of filmmaking and work in a variety of genres – fiction, commercials and documentary. Each class is structured around small production teams in which students produce their own movies and crew on team member projects. In this way, students get personalized instruction, maximum experience with the equipment, and create material for their demo reels.

Feature Films


SFSDF is also the only film school in the country offering every student the valuable experience of crewing on a professional feature-length motion picture through its sister company, Fog City Pictures. In the past year, Fog City Pictures has produced two feature films with a talented array of award-winning actors and filmmakers.
